Type
ORACLE
Validation date
2025-10-11 06: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.4464e-4,
    "usd": 2.8434e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F0B32A67B2D8C2B3BE089BCD52551C378FB4820B8DE07B88FE3DF93F47FB98DF

Previous signature

1298255FA893609B3170F90D259CCECEBDC90143E70546E8D7544F5669C80A4C6E1710CA1B525C2346DEDE76C79F227A2C50A3CFD2330E86050E0A2BD8A7A70A

Origin signature

3045022100F83A56CA846CED0718FD4FE55B72F14948597AD1639D748A3FE4F9AD7E70408A02205F8ED6D356E696B383769706760CBFD5A61484ECC0D9FDE324A302A350C8A7D7

Proof of work

01010446C07B9C824CC66375D105395F1B72ECF048FC7AE62B8D23A3DD7A6A868EA83C42D7ECC4CEC8143E6BFB175AE44DC210BFE3DA1A4E26A9585ABE077CFF4913FB

Proof of integrity

0066B455E80970B1DF6096B450CD0130FB0EA34DD88D4F239105C700AC25A92797

Coordinator signature

0824EC042943124DB9A229D121DCD9A20611D9FEEA6EF3C8FC08D90DBA7A005CD7BCC0560DF0DAD1A08EA796F88FED1E16FBAA48BA5975EC5D66469ED4A2F504

Validator #1 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#1 signature

B33FDF4416744576D78DA5EE46E8AEC58D8D91B5EB1CCC96ABB3BDA4A34A1A753CD5269B4D508E68E7538B9F6BD48F816D9A2FCB26A58F30492037F0CD280509

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

C5837C6E498FD081DFE6B46259CE266597EEFDE159DA9A3691916D62F834D963172CC59D1310609E3499DC1AF4ADF53A92B4585D9310CEE36AB64D38E98B7608